The Bromfield School, located in Harvard, Massachusetts, has prioritized climate action through its cafeteria operations, classroom teachings, and overall school values. Bromfield School collects leftover food scraps from the cafeteria to send to a local farm for animal feed. For long-term success, students created a training video to […]

School Spotlight: Mashpee Middle/High School
Mashpee Middle/High School’s Green Team, led by Shona Vitelli, has reduced lunchroom waste by 70% with reusable trays and food waste recycling. Learn how this school is transforming sustainability and reducing its environmental footprint.
